Common Myths About LASIK and PRK
Many people have mistaken beliefs about LASIK and PRK that can cloud their decision-making. One common misconception is that these treatments are just for those with serious vision concerns. In reality, LASIK and PRK can remedy a variety of refractive mistakes, consisting of nearsightedness, farsightedness, and astigmatism.
An additional myth is the belief that the surgical treatments hurt. Many people experience marginal discomfort throughout the process, thanks to numbing eye decreases. Some may additionally worry about an extensive recuperation; nonetheless, many go back to their day-to-day tasks within a day or two.
Furthermore, there's a misunderstanding that as soon as you have the surgical treatment, you'll never ever need glasses once more. While several achieve 20/20 vision, some may still need glasses for details tasks as they age.
Understanding the Safety And Security and Efficiency of Vision Adjustment Surgical Procedure
While taking into consideration vision correction surgery, you might question its security and efficiency. Normally, these treatments, like LASIK and PRK, are risk-free and have high success prices. A lot of patients experience significant enhancements in their vision, commonly accomplishing 20/25 vision or far better.
Nevertheless, it's essential to bear in mind that, like any surgical treatment, risks exist. You can face complications such as completely dry eyes or glow, yet major concerns are uncommon.

Long-Term Outcomes and Considerations for People
As you take into consideration the long-lasting results of vision correction surgical treatment, it's critical to comprehend exactly how your sight may alter over time. Many individuals experience stable vision for several years after the procedure, yet some may notice steady changes due to age or other variables.
Normal eye exams are necessary to check these adjustments and guarantee your vision remains ideal. It's also crucial to discuss any type of worry about your eye professional, as they can offer guidance customized to your special circumstance.
While a lot of people take pleasure in improved vision, you need to be prepared for the possibility of requiring glasses or contact lenses later in life. Inevitably, staying informed and positive concerning your eye wellness can aid you maintain the best possible vision outcomes.
